Verdict: poor odds, for a 5 / 10 build.
The middle developer here made $670, ×1.1 the market's $630 for a 5 / 10 build, and 3 in 10 made under $90; 1 in 20 cleared $770k, ×1231 the market median. Revenue is up 180% on the market; 56 games are announced against 24 developers who shipped in the last year.

What kills games here
3 in 10 developers made under $90. 9 in 10 of the 15 games released 1 to 2 years ago have fewer than 100 reviews. 56 games are announced against 24 developers who shipped in the last year, ×2.3 per shipper.
